Transaction 84c3e94a9b21a39d27ca2eb3f97246a67653e2a8222c426358efc38419b7bcf4
1 Input
1 Output
-
84c3e94a9b21a39d27ca2eb3f97246a67653e2a8222c426358efc38419b7bcf4:0
- value
- 3880829
- script pubkey
- OP_0 OP_PUSHBYTES_20 84add764f5170abc4b70f2996239aa082c1b3457
- address
- ltc1qsjkawe84zu9tcjms72vkywd2pqkpkdzhvvmp5u